| Lines of business: |
Unmanned air vehicles, simulation and test systems, AAI/ACL Technologies Inc., engineering and maintenance services and energy systems |
| Major customers: |
Army and Department of Defense |
| Major contracts/projects: |
United Industrial is working on a 10-year agreement with the Department of Defense to provide maintenance services, spare parts and logistics for U.S. Navy and Air Force Joint Service Electronic Combat Systems Tester units. |
